Bangladeshi arrested
On January 19, around noon, on receiving inputs that around 30 to 40 Bangladeshi nationals were suspiciously moving around Balijhora village, West Garo Hills, police rushed to the spot and apprehended one Md. Mofuzul Hoque (28) of Haluahati village, Sherpur, Bangladesh and seized one mobile phone from his possession. During inquiry, he could not produce any valid documents and revealed that he entered into India, illegally.

Coal-laden trucks found
On January 21, around 11.45 am, police detected four trucks (AS-01CC-6379, AS-11DC-4584, NL-01AD-2764 and AS-11CC-9686) without drivers, parked at Mynkre Petrol Pump East Jaintia Hills loaded with coal in violation of NGT order.
On January 20, police detected two dumper trucks (ML-10B-8821 and ML10B-8841) at Lad Rymbai Dongwah Petrol Pump (EJH), reportedly meant for use of transportation of coal.

Bikes stolen
Samuel Infimate lodged a complaint that on January 21, miscreants stole his motorcycle (ML-05R-0580), which was parked inside his residential compound at Lower New Colony, Shillong.
Ridhi Talukdar lodged a complaint that on January 21 between 2 am and 4 am, miscreants stole his motorcycle (ML-05P-8726), which was parked at Pynthorbah, Block-I, Shillong.
